Quintiq file version 2.0
|
#parent: PanelSCV/MenuSetFocus
|
Response OnClick (
|
structured[shadow[SCVPISPIPNode]] selection
|
) id:Response_customdrawContextMenuSCV_MenuSetFocus_OnClick
|
{
|
#keys: '[139394.0.533524219]'
|
CanBindMultiple: false
|
DefinitionID => /PanelSCV/Responsedef_customdrawContextMenuSCV_MenuSetFocus_OnClick
|
Precondition:
|
[*
|
// Forced to do this because the response isn't fired when bind to shadow[SCVPISPIPNode]
|
// the response is intended for single node
|
return selection.Size() = 1;
|
*]
|
QuillAction
|
{
|
Body:
|
[*
|
// Focus scv node
|
// Update nav panel selection
|
pispips := selectset( selection, Elements.ProductInStockingPointInPeriod, pispip, true );
|
Form.UpdateNavPanelSelections( pispips, true /*isfocus*/ );
|
*]
|
GroupServerCalls: false
|
}
|
}
|